Chainlink Expands Institutional Reach With SGX FX Onchain Data Push

Singapore-based SGX FX has integrated Chainlink technology to bring institutional foreign exchange pricing onto blockchain networks. Using Chainlink DataLink, the platform will distribute benchmark OTC FX data across more than 75 blockchains, initially covering spot and one-month forward rates for major currency pairs. The move strengthens infrastructure connecting traditional finance with tokenized assets and decentralized finance markets. Supporters see the partnership as another step toward institutional blockchain adoption, while reinforcing Chainlink’s growing role as critical middleware for trusted financial data globally today.
